What Are SARMs and How Do They Work?

SARM represents selective androgen receptor modulator, and it’s a kind of drug that’s chemically comparable to anabolic steroids.
There are several SARMs on the marketplace, and some are stronger and have a greater threat of side effects than others.
The more popular ones are …
  1. MK-2866 or GTx-024 (Ostarine).
  2. LGD-4033 (Ligandrol).
  3. LGD-3303.
  4. GSX-007 or S-4 (Andarine).
  5. GW-501516 (Cardarine).

Why the odd alphanumeric names, you wonder?

Well, SARMs have not been approved for medical use, so pharmaceutical online marketers have not bothered calling them yet. Presently, they’re only offered as “research chemicals” meant for clinical use, however more on that in a moment.
Now, to understand how these drugs work, we first need to take a look at the physiology of hormonal agents.
Hormonal agents are chemical messengers that your body utilizes to communicate with cells.
You can think about them as outgoing mail that contains essential directions, and when they reach the cells’ “mail boxes”– hormonal agent receptors– the commands are performed.
Androgens are hormonal agents that produce masculinity (deeper voice, facial hair, more muscle and lower body fat levels, etc). The most popular androgen is testosterone, but there are others also.
Androgens apply their impacts in the body in three primary ways:
  1. Binding to your cells’ androgen receptors.
  2. Transforming to the hormone dihydrotestosterone (DHT), which then binds to androgen receptors.
  3. Converting to the hormonal agent estradiol (estrogen), which binds to a different type of receptor on cells (estrogen receptor).
Under normal circumstances, your body carefully regulates androgen production, relying on delicate feedback mechanisms to prevent imbalances.
When you present anabolic steroids into the body, however, your cells become flooded with androgens– many that all offered receptors become totally saturated.
This sends an extremely effective message to all cells that are listening, consisting of muscle cells, which proliferate in reaction.
That sounds like good times to us weightlifters, however then there are the liabilities.
Research shows that some of the adverse effects of steroid use are reversible and some aren’t. Permanent damage is possible.
Reversible changes include testicular atrophy (shrinking), acne, cysts, oily hair and skin, elevated blood pressure and “bad” cholesterol levels, increased aggressiveness, and lowered sperm count.
Permanent damage consists of male-pattern baldness, heart dysfunction, liver disease, and gynecomastia (breast development).
Another major downside to steroids is the risk of biological and mental dependency.
One study carried out by scientists at Harvard Medical School discovered that 30% of steroid users established a dependence syndrome, and if you talk to adequate truthful drug users, you’ll hear everything about their addictive properties.
Now, for years, researchers have actually been trying to establish steroids or steroid-like drugs that aren’t as destructive to individuals’s health and well-being, and supplement online marketers claim that SARMs are just that.
They’re non-steroidal drugs developed to promote the androgen receptors in simply muscle and bone cells, having little impact on the other cells in the body, and thus the endocrine system as a whole.
In a sense, taking regular ol’ anabolic steroids resembles carpet bombing your system with androgens. It does the job, however it’s careless and leads to a great deal of civilian casualties.
Taking SARMs, however, is like drone striking just the asshole whistleblower reporters … er … I indicate, bad guy terrorists.
Simply put, SARMs can tell your muscle cells to grow without all the sound and mess caused by anabolic steroids.
Technically speaking, SARMs achieve this in two ways:
  1. They have a special affinity for certain tissues like muscle and bone, however not for others, like the brain, liver, and prostate.
  2. They do not break down into unwanted molecules that cause negative effects, like DHT and estrogen, as easily.
This 2nd point is rather considerable.
One key attribute of SARMs is they’re not easily converted by an enzyme called 5-a reductase into DHT, a driver of many undesirable side effects of steroid use.
SARMs are likewise resistant to the enzyme aromatase, which transforms testosterone into estrogen.
Lastly, due to the fact that SARMs are less powerful than regular steroids, they do not suppress natural testosterone production as greatly, making them simpler to recover from.
SARMs are a miracle drug that mimics a number of the effects of testosterone in muscle and bone tissue, while (ideally) having a very little impact on other organs. Hence, the theory is that you can have the benefits of steroids with none of the disadvantages.

Why Do People Supplement With SARMs?

SARMs were originally developed for people with diseases like muscle wasting, osteoporosis, anemia, and persistent fatigue.
They were planned to be a healthier option to testosterone replacement treatment. Whether they’re going to meet that vision is yet to be identified.
Now, bodybuilders typically take SARMs for one of two factors:
  1. To “get their feet damp” with anabolic substance abuse before going into traditional steroid cycles.
  2. To increase the efficiency of steroid cycles without exacerbating adverse effects or health risks.
Since they help keep lean mass but don’t seem to increase water retention, lots of bodybuilders likewise think that SARMs are specifically handy for cutting.
How well do these drugs work?

Well, research study reveals that SARMs aren’t as powerful for muscle building as standard steroids, however they’re certainly more efficient than anything natural you can take (like creatine).

Because they’re more difficult to find in drug screening, they’re likewise popular among professional athletes.

Are SARMs Safe?

Nonsteroidal SARMs have only been around for a number of decades and, sadly, are lacking in human research.
We just don’t understand adequate about how they work and their possible long-term negative effects, which is a really legitimate cause for concern.
Additionally, considering that all SARMs offered online are technically black-market products, they’re not subject to any oversight whatsoever and quality assurance is often a concern. Mislabeling, contamination, and other shenanigans are common occurrences.
Here’s what we do know …

SARMs reduce your natural testosterone production.

Among the crucial selling points for a number of these drugs is the claim that they don’t blunt your body’s production of testosterone.
This is a lie. They absolutely do.
For example, in one study carried out by scientists at the behest of GTx, Inc., a pharmaceutical company that specializes in making SARMs, male topics taking 3 mg of the SARM ostarine daily for 86 days experienced a 23% drop in totally free testosterone and 43% drop in overall testosterone levels (during the trial).
As GTx, Inc. produces and sells SARMs, they had no incentive to make the outcomes look worse than they actually were. They were incentivized to do the opposite and underreport the negative side results (there’s no evidence this was done, however I’m just making a point).
Similar results were seen in another research study carried out by scientists at Boston University with the SARM ligandrol. In this case, 76 guys aged 21 to 50 experienced a massive 55% drop in total testosterone levels after taking 1 mg of ligandrol daily for just 3 weeks. Disturbingly, it also took 5 weeks for their natural testosterone production to recover.
In fact, SARMs are being examined as a male contraceptive due to the fact that they lower your levels of luteinizing hormone and follicle-stimulating hormone, which decreases your sperm count and testosterone levels.
All this isn’t surprising when you consider the basic physiology in play:
It reacts and recognizes the spike by reducing its own production of its own similar hormonal agents when you present androgens into the body.
Despite what SARM hucksters claim, SARMs definitely due depress your natural testosterone production, and the more you take, the more your natural testosterone levels will drop.

The more SARMs you take, the more side effects you’ll experience.

SARMs aren’t totally free from adverse effects– they just tend to be very little at little dosages.
Bodybuilders don’t typically take little doses, however, and that’s why they frequently experience much of the adverse effects associated with steroid usage, including acne and loss of hair.
This likewise applies to the suppression of testosterone you simply learnt more about. The more exogenous (originating outside an organism) anabolic hormonal agents you introduce into your body, whether from SARMs or plain ol’ testosterone, the more your natural production will fall.
And according to a study conducted by researchers at Copenhagen University, it’s possible that this decrease in natural testosterone production might continue for years after you stop taking steroids (or SARMs).
On paper, SARMs appear to be simpler on the body than conventional steroids, consisting of testosterone. If you take enough to see significant advantages, though, then possibilities are good you’ll also encounter substantial negative effects.

SARMs are probably much easier to recuperate from than routine steroids.

We recall that they don’t convert into DHT or estrogen in the same way as steroids, which means they likewise don’t impact your system as negatively.
SARMs likewise aren’t as anabolic as pure testosterone, which indicates they most likely don’t suppress natural testosterone as much, too (although there isn’t adequate research offered to understand for sure).
That stated, if you take enough to experience substantial advantages, you’re likely also taking adequate to experience significant unfavorable effects. That’s just the nature of drugs– they cut both ways and you constantly need to weigh the excellent and the bad.
Moreover, if you take sufficient SARMs to trigger a few of the more serious adverse effects such as loss of hair, gynecomastia, and so on, they might be irreversible– just as with anabolic steroid use.
Anecdotally, many people do report recuperating from SARM usage much faster than conventional steroid cycles. You need to take such stories with a grain of salt, though, as a number of these individuals have actually likewise used considerably lower dosages of SARMs than they ever did of steroids, so it’s not a true apples-to-apples comparison.
Plus, as you’ll discover in a moment, it’s totally possible the stuff these individuals were taking wasn’t even SARMs.
The negative results of SARMs may be much easier to recover from as soon as you stop taking them than standard steroids, although this idea is largely based on bodybuilder anecdotes instead of clinical research.

SARMs may raise your danger of cancer.

A number of big trials on the SARM cardarine had to be canceled since it was causing cancerous growths in the intestinal tracts of mice.
You may have become aware of this, which the dosages utilized were much higher than us fitness folk would ever consume, however that’s not true.
Rodents get rid of some drugs from their bodies much faster than we do, so they have to get higher doses to see the same results.
In the case cited above, the mice were given 10 mg per kg of cardarine each day, which, when changed for a human metabolism, comes out to about 75 mg per day for a 200-pound guy.
Poke around on bodybuilding forums and you’ll quickly learn that lots of bodybuilders take substantially more than that.
Granted, you can’t theorize rodent research to human beings (despite sharing ~ 98% of their DNA, we aren’t huge mice), so it’s unclear if that drug or other SARMs really do increase our danger of developing cancer.
There’s also evidence that SARMs may actually inhibit specific sort of cancer, so we simply do not understand yet.
If you ask me, this is simply another reason why I think that SARMs are last and first a high-risk, low-reward proposal.
They’re billed as a less harmful option to traditional steroids like testosterone, they’re also much less studied and comprehended, which is why numerous experts believe SARMs are a riskier choice. Better the devil you know than the devil you do not.
There’s evidence that SARMs might increase your risk of cancer and little understood about the security of these drugs in general. When you take them, you’re playing guinea pig and only time will inform what the outcomes will be.

Lots of SARM products aren’t what they claim to be.

We recall that SARMs can just be lawfully sold as “research study chemicals.”
To put it simply, the only people who are supposed to purchase SARMs are scientists wanting to learn more about how they actually work and whether or not they have beneficial pharmaceutical uses.
Naturally, the huge bulk of SARMs you see for sale online never ever end up in a laboratory. Instead, they discover their method into bodybuilders, professional athletes, and fitness enthusiasts who want to get more jacked.
This unlocks to all kinds of skulduggery, consisting of:
    1. Contaminating the drugs with poisonous chemicals due to poor quality control or cutting corners during production.
    2. Blending them with weaker and often damaging substances to increase profits.
    3. Mislabeling them to increase profits.
Damning evidence of this can be found in a research study conducted by the United States Anti-Doping Company (USADA) that involved purchasing 44 SARM items from 21 various online suppliers.
The scientists also took things a step further by asking all of the sellers to provide what’s referred to as a “chain-of-custody” of the items, which identifies whose hands the products travelled through once they were produced (and hence who had the chance to tamper with them).
After analyzing the items, the scientists discovered that …
  1. Only 52% of the items included any traces of SARMs at all.
  2. 25% of the items consisted of doses substantially lower than what was on the label.
  3. 25% of the products contained no or simply trace amounts of the SARM on the label, and rather included unlabeled substances such as other SARMs and the estrogen blockers androstenetrione and tamoxifen.
The bottom line is the SARM market is a lawless free-for-all and that probably isn’t going to change anytime quickly.
There’s presently no federal government company forcing SARMs manufacturers to toe the line, and as the research study from USADA reveals, numerous producers are fully familiar with this and are more interested in making a profit than anything else.
A lot of the products presently offered as SARMs either don’t consist of any SARMs or contain other hidden chemicals and potentially hazardous compounds.

The Bottom Line on SARMs

SARMs are drugs that deliver some of the benefits of anabolic steroids with fewer of the short-term side-effects.
They aren’t as effective as steroids, however they definitely do increase muscle development more than any natural supplement on the marketplace. They seem more secure, too, but do not believe that indicates they’re safe to take.
Research study clearly reveals that they suppress natural testosterone production and negatively affect the endocrine system, and there’s evidence that they can increase the danger of cancer, too.
Furthermore, we have no idea if there are long-term health results of SARM use, but given the nature of the drugs, there likely are.
There’s likewise excellent proof that many of the items presently sold as SARMs do not actually contain SARMs and may also include other drugs, fillers, and harmful contaminants.
So, if you want a cut-and-dried suggestion from me, it’s this:
Keep away from SARMs.
In my viewpoint, the threats far exceed the advantages, and they’re simply not necessary to build a muscular, strong, and lean body that you can be happy with.
